Ticket #— Vault locked out, FeeForge rules engine deploy blocked

Hey team — the config vault for FeeForge (our shipping-fee rules engine) locked itself after too many failed unseal attempts during last night's deploy. Until it's unsealed, rule updates for the Marlow zone surcharges won't publish, so customers may see stale fees. Ops says we can manually unseal using the standby procedure. I dug the recovery passphrase out of the sealed envelope in the runbook binder, and here it is.

vault phrase of taweg-kafof = oliax-zorael

Hey Marit,

Quick handover before I'm out. I finished vendoring the Quellsans and Norrow font families into the Pindrift repo — licenses are in /vendor/fonts/LICENSES, so please double-check those during review. The font manifest table also needs reseeding after merge, which is a one-liner with the seed script. For that you'll want the staging database, reachable with the connection string below.

replica DSN, yahaf-yagaf: mongodb://tamath_svc:a2netSk3RZMuTj@db-d084.novacsoft.internal:5432/ralmir

MEMO — Draventon Plant Capacity

To the Board: demand for the Kelrix line exceeds Draventon's output by 18%. Options assessed: third shift (fastest, highest labour risk), line expansion (capex-heavy, 14-month lead), or contract manufacturing via Orsten Fabrication (margin dilution, quickest scale). Management recommends the third shift with phased expansion approval in Q3. Full cost models are attached. Decision requested at the next session. Board members should first note the following.

board note of kagep-yahig: Only 9 of the 120 pilot accounts renewed Quenix, so a churn review is set for April 1.

External plugin authors integrating with the Drossel platform should understand how trace context propagates. Every inbound request to the Vellum gateway is stamped with a correlation header, which downstream services — including your plugin's sandbox — must forward unchanged. Dropping the header breaks the provenance chain, and the Ashgrove audit job will flag your plugin's builds as unverifiable. Each published plugin artifact is signed against the trace context of the build that produced it. That build is identified by the token below.

build token for kagaf-hahof: htk14_9d3d4d26d7d8de